Cinderella’s Castle at Walt Disney World

 

  • Park Reservations and valid tickets are still required for guests wishing to visit a Walt Disney World theme park.  All guests are also required to wear masks in all public areas at all times (unless sitting to eat or visiting a relaxation station). Guests are also encouraged to visit Disney’s Know Before You Go section to stay up to date on all current requirements, refurbishments, and offerings.
  • Park Hoppers have returned!  In order to HOP, guests must purchase tickets with the hopper option. Additionally, they must have a Park Reservation for the first park and visit that park first. Guests can begin hopping at 2:00 if there is availability.  Parks available for hopping can be verified by calling 407-560-5000. Parks that are at capacity will not allow hopping. However, guests can always return to the park where they had their original Park Reservation, even if this park hits capacity.
  • Early Theme Park Entry available for Disney Resort guests.  While Extra Magic Hours are currently suspended, guests of Disney Resorts and select other locations are able to enter all theme parks 30 minutes prior to opening, every day.  Park Reservations and tickets are still required for entry.

  • Changes coming to Disney’s Magical Express-beginning in January 2022, Walt Disney World is retiring their Magical Express transfer service.  At this time, details are not being offered for any replacement services for airport to resort transfer. For those wanting to plan ahead, Uber and Lyft are both viable options. However, many guests prefer the service of a private transfer from a reputable company such as Orlando Airport Towncar. Their service includes flight monitoring, in-airport meet & greet,  Publix 20-minute grocery stop (must request), and safe transfer.
  • Walt Disney World has also ended their partnership with Star Transportation.  Private transfers are currently unavailable through the Walt Disney Travel Company.

  • Walt Disney World Refurbishments-official updates can be found on the Walt Disney Know Before You Go Resort Updates section of the website
    • The Bay Cove Pool water play area will be closed for refurbishments from January 6-February of 2021 (Bay Lake Tower at Disney’s Contemporary Resort)
    • The Big Blue Pool at Disney’s Art of Animation will be closed for refurbishments from January 11-April of 2021.
    • The Great Ceremonial House at Disney’s Polynesian Village Resort is currently undergoing refurbishments. As a result, the monorail station at this resort is temporarily closed.  Guests are advised to use one of the other Magic Kingdom Resorts (Contemporary, Grand Floridian) or the Transportation and Ticket Center for monorail access.
    • The Hippy Dippy Pool at Disney’s Pop Century Resort will be closed for refurbishments from February 15-March 2021.
    • The Paddock Pool waterslide and the connecting walking bridge at Disney’s Saratoga Springs Resort & Spa are closed for refurbishment. The pool area is still open, but guests are asked to follow the alternate walking route for access.

  • Disney Cruise Line has suspended all departures through April 2021 and select Disney Wonder/Disney Magic sailings through May 2021.
    • According to Disney Travel Agents, affected sailings include “Disney Fantasy through April 24; Disney Dream through April 30; Disney Magic through May 6; Disney  Wonder through May 12”
    • Paid in full reservations are eligible for a 125% FCC or a full refund.  FCC must be used by May 31, 2022.
    • Partially paid reservations will receive a full refund of all monies paid.
  • Disney Cruise Line sailings longer than 7-nights have been canceled. 
    • Paid in full guests are eligible for 125% FCC or full refund. FCC must be used by May 31, 2022.
    • Partially paid reservations will receive a full refund.
    • Additional discount for certain sailings. Guests originally booked on the June 28 9-Night Alaska Wonder are being offered a 10% discount if rebooked on the June 28 seven-night Alaskan cruise or July 5 two-night Seattle cruise; guests booked on the 9-Night July 22 Southern Caribbean Disney Fantasy sailing are being offered a 10% discount if rebooked on the July 22 3-night Bahamian cruise or July 25 6-Night Western Caribbean cruise.
  • 2-Night Seattle sailing on the Disney Wonder now available to book!
    • Sets sail July 5, 2021
    • The itinerary includes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ada; Seattle Washington;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ada
  • Final Payment extension, cancelation policy, and more!
    • Final payment for sailings through August 31, 2021, are now due 60 days prior to departure.
    • Cancelation policies have been adjusted to reflect a 14-60 day policy, based on cruise length and cabin category.
    • Flexible booking policy allows guests to change their sail date up until 15 days prior to sailing without penalty.

  • Cancelation and Modification policy extended to June 10, 2021 arrivals
    • Currently booked “room only” guests have up until 24 hours prior to arrival to cancel or modify travel dates without penalty; guests that cancel within 24 hours of arrival will be charged a one-night room fee plus tax.
    • Currently booked package guests can also cancel or modify without penalty up until 24 hours prior to arrival; guests that cancel within 24 hours of arrival will be charged a $400 penalty.
  • Cancelation and Modification policy for guests booked after June 10, 2021
    • “Room Only” cancelations and changes must be completed 5 days prior to arrival to avoid penalties and fees; cancelations and changes made within 4 days of arrival will be charged a one-night fee plus tax.
    • Package cancelations must be completed 30 days prior to arrival to avoid penalties and fees; cancelations and changes made within 29 days of arrival will be charged a $400 penalty.
